What is Retail CRM?
A retail crm, or retail customer relationship management, system focuses on managing customer data. This supports exceptional customer service by fostering positive customer interactions and cultivating customer loyalty. It can also record the customer’s purchase history.
Given the variety of crm systems available, how can a business choose the most suitable management software? A solid management system begins with understanding the specific benefits a crm offers to retail businesses.
Key Functions of Retail CRM Systems
How do crm systems operate, and what features does retail crm software typically include? Here are some standard functions:
- Contact Management: Store essential customer details such as names, addresses, emails, and phone numbers.
- Purchase History: Monitor each customer’s purchases to gain insights into their preferences and buying behavior. This data also helps with management mobile crm efforts.
- Customer Interactions: Log every interaction across various channels, including in-store visits, online chats, social media posts, emails, and phone calls.
- Personalized Marketing: Utilize customer data insights to create targeted marketing campaigns.
- Customer Segmentation: Sort customers into distinct categories based on shared characteristics to improve the effectiveness of targeted marketing campaigns.
- Sales Automation: Automate repetitive sales tasks to streamline your sales cycle and improve efficiency.
- Customer Service and Customer Support: Deliver exceptional customer support by promptly addressing customer inquiries and resolving issues.

How to Successfully Implement Retail CRM
Many executives understand that successful crm implementation can be challenging. One aspect that can make or break the adoption of customer relationship control software is change control management, as this directly impacts customer satisfaction.
Does a company or its leaders truly manage the changes that occur when their employees adopt new behaviors or workflows?
Training and Onboarding
Set up thorough training and onboarding programs for new users. Training will help everyone understand the platform’s features and how it aligns with sales and support cycles.
Data Migration
Transfer existing customer data smoothly and accurately into the new system. Appropriately clean the data from a single database to maintain data and analytics accuracy.
Phased Rollout
Applying small, controlled steps can help for an orderly transition during the rollout of a CRM system. This phased rollout should be part of the overall process automation strategy.
Test a single attribute initially and then expand based on its performance. A careful, incremental increase limits risk associated with unexpected problems and business disturbance. Short iteration times also helps preserve agility while maintaining reasonable incremental cost to guarantee correct modifications.
Measuring Success Metrics and ROI
Tracking is essential to understanding progress. Define key metrics to measure the effectiveness of your crm implementation.
- Conversion rates.
- Customer satisfaction scores.
- Sales growth.
- Customer retention rate.
Set measurable and realistic goals. Regularly evaluate metrics to determine which attributes provide the best return on investment. Evaluate which marketing strategies are the most successful.
